However, as it is the only decent kit on the market and taking that
you don't want to scratch-build :-) Here is how I would suggest you
open up the those akward little Matra pods openings. Firstly, get your
ever useful dremel or Minicraft drill. determine what size drill you
want to open up the holes. Then choose the size below! then carefully
drill into the holes using a pin vice or similar to hold the pods,
once they are all opened up, get a needle file and carefully open up
to the required size, trying to leave the characteristic inner cone to
the opening. As I said I hav'nt looked at this kit for a while. But if
you can drill from the back instead of the front, that may help. Once
opened up you may wish to insert a dummy blanking plate to stop seeing
right through.
That's How I would tackle it, but there is more than one way to skin a
cat, but I hope it helps.
